Subtract 6/30 from 64/7
1st number: 9 1/7, 2nd number: 6/30
64/7 - 6/30 is 313/35.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 7 and 30 is 210
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 210 - For the 1st fraction, since 7 × 30 = 210,
64/7 = 64 × 30/7 × 30 = 1920/210 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 30 × 7 = 210,
6/30 = 6 × 7/30 × 7 = 42/210 - Subtract the two like fractions:
1920/210 - 42/210 = 1920 - 42/210 = 1878/210 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is 313/35
- In mixed form: 833/35
